什么是协议爆破?
协议爆破是指对网络协议进行破解或绕过的行为,以获取未授权的数据或控制权限。协议爆破通常涉及对网络传输中的数据进行分析,以找出漏洞并加以利用。在GitHub这样的开放平台上,用户常常会分享相关的代码和工具,助长了此类行为的传播。
GitHub上协议爆破的常见工具
在GitHub上,有许多与协议爆破相关的工具,以下是一些最常用的工具:
- Burp Suite:一个广泛使用的网络安全测试工具,可以用来检测和利用网络协议的漏洞。
- Metasploit:一个强大的渗透测试框架,能够进行协议爆破并帮助安全研究人员发现漏洞。
- OWASP ZAP:开源的网页应用安全扫描器,适用于检测协议安全问题。
协议爆破的原理
协议爆破的原理通常包括以下几个步骤:
- 信息收集:通过工具获取目标系统的基本信息和网络协议的详情。
- 漏洞分析:利用扫描工具检测协议的漏洞。
- 执行攻击:在发现漏洞后,使用适当的工具进行爆破或绕过。
GitHub协议爆破的实例
案例一:使用Burp Suite进行协议爆破
- 步骤一:配置Burp Suite,设定代理和拦截规则。
- 步骤二:发起请求,观察返回结果。
- 步骤三:利用Burp Suite的各种插件进行漏洞测试。
案例二:使用Metasploit进行攻击
- 步骤一:选择相应的模块进行攻击。
- 步骤二:配置攻击参数。
- 步骤三:运行攻击并分析结果。
协议爆破的安全隐患
协议爆破可能带来的安全隐患包括:
- 数据泄露:敏感信息可能被恶意获取。
- 服务中断:攻击者可能通过协议爆破使服务瘫痪。
- 法律责任:进行非法协议爆破可能导致法律责任。
如何防范协议爆破
为了保护系统安全,可以采取以下防范措施:
- 使用强密码:确保所有帐户和服务使用强而复杂的密码。
- 定期更新:及时更新软件和网络协议,修复已知漏洞。
- 启用防火墙:配置防火墙规则,阻止非法访问。
协议爆破的法律与伦理问题
进行协议爆破不仅涉及技术问题,还存在法律与伦理问题。未授权的协议爆破行为属于网络攻击,可能导致法律诉讼及刑事责任。因此,在进行相关活动时,应遵循道德和法律规范。
FAQ(常见问题解答)
1. 什么是协议爆破?
协议爆破是通过对网络协议进行破解以获取未授权访问的一种网络攻击行为。它可能会导致敏感数据泄露和服务中断。
2. 如何在GitHub上找到协议爆破的工具?
在GitHub上,可以通过搜索相关关键词如“协议爆破工具”或“网络安全工具”找到多种资源和项目。
3. 协议爆破会带来哪些安全风险?
协议爆破可能导致数据泄露、服务中断,甚至法律责任等一系列安全隐患。
4. 如何防止我的项目被协议爆破?
建议使用强密码,定期更新软件,启用防火墙,并且保持对安全动态的关注,以增强系统的安全性。
5. 是否所有的协议都能被爆破?
不是所有的协议都有漏洞可供爆破。安全性较高的协议会采取多种措施防范攻击。
结语
协议爆破在网络安全中是一个重要的话题,理解其原理、工具和防范措施是每个开发者和安全人员的必修课。通过在GitHub上学习和应用相关知识,可以有效提升个人和团队的安全意识与技能。
正文完